Transaction 83f3d538c0335de9e3b7933992bdbed696086eac4739760156c12e6054a3d35d
1 Input
1 Output
-
83f3d538c0335de9e3b7933992bdbed696086eac4739760156c12e6054a3d35d:0
- value
- 510806
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a7816817b0a75501cdb922147f469599bfd90f7c OP_EQUAL
- address
- 3GxhnueCuJn4wJerb7H2ffkvC8uQTAvvex